Babysitter Job: The C Family with 1 Child
We are adopting, and we expect to be home with our baby in early July. We do not have grandparents in town, and we are looking for someone loving and dependable to help our family. I am a former teacher and worked as a nanny when I was in school, so I would especially love to work with a nanny who is studying to work with children or families in some capacity.
We will need someone to look after our baby in our home about 12 to 20 hours a week. This would be mostly during the day, but we would love an occasional evening of babysitting. Help with dishes, baby's laundry, and other light housework would be great. We would also appreciate it if you could run the occasional errand.
We are very flexible and can work around your school schedule. We will pay $15/hour as a starting salary, but considering education, experience, and quality of care, we would love to pay more to someone who is a great fit for our family.
Current infant CPR certification is required. Experience with newborns and/or infants would be great! The main thing is that you are patient, kind, and love children.
We have three cats, so our nanny would need to be comfortable with cats.
Please reach out if you would like to learn more about our family. Have a great summer!
